Etymology edit
(Orkney, Shetland) From Old Norse há (“high”) + ey (“island”).
Proper noun edit
Hoy (countable and uncountable, plural Hoys)
- A surname.
- An island in south-west Orkney Islands council area, Scotland (OS grid refs HY20, ND29).
- A small uninhabited island in the Shetland Islands council area, Scotland (OS grid ref HU3744).
- An unincorporated community in Hampshire County, West Virginia, United States.
Statistics edit
- According to the 2010 United States Census, Hoy is the 3855th most common surname in the United States, belonging to 9196 individuals. Hoy is most common among White (85.3%) individuals.
